SOTAVerified

Code Documentation Generation

Code Documentation Generation is a supervised task where a code function is the input to the model, and the model generates the documentation for this function.

Description from: CodeTrans: Towards Cracking the Language of Silicone's Code Through Self-Supervised Deep Learning and High Performance Computing

Papers

Showing 18 of 8 papers

TitleStatusHype
DocAgent: A Multi-Agent System for Automated Code Documentation GenerationCode3
RepoAgent: An LLM-Powered Open-Source Framework for Repository-level Code Documentation GenerationCode4
A Comparative Analysis of Large Language Models for Code Documentation Generation0
Assemble Foundation Models for Automatic Code SummarizationCode1
Memorization and Generalization in Neural Code Intelligence ModelsCode0
CodeTrans: Towards Cracking the Language of Silicon's Code Through Self-Supervised Deep Learning and High Performance ComputingCode1
HAConvGNN: Hierarchical Attention Based Convolutional Graph Neural Network for Code Documentation Generation in Jupyter NotebooksCode0
CodeBERT: A Pre-Trained Model for Programming and Natural LanguagesCode1
Show:102550

Benchmark Results

#ModelMetricClaimedVerifiedStatus
1CodeTrans-MT-LargeSmoothed BLEU-421.87Unverified
2CodeBERT (MLM+RTD)Smoothed BLEU-414.56Unverified
3CodeBERT (MLM)Smoothed BLEU-413.59Unverified
4RoBERTaSmoothed BLEU-413.2Unverified
5pre-train w/ code onlySmoothed BLEU-413.07Unverified
6CodeBERT (RTD)Smoothed BLEU-412.72Unverified
7TransformerSmoothed BLEU-412.57Unverified
8seq2seqSmoothed BLEU-411.42Unverified
#ModelMetricClaimedVerifiedStatus
1TransformerSmoothed BLEU-425.61Unverified
2CodeTrans-TF-LargeSmoothed BLEU-418.98Unverified
3CodeBERT (MLM+RTD)Smoothed BLEU-49.54Unverified
4CodeBERT (RTD)Smoothed BLEU-48.73Unverified
5CodeBERT (MLM)Smoothed BLEU-48.51Unverified
6pre-train w/ code onlySmoothed BLEU-48.3Unverified
7seq2seqSmoothed BLEU-46.88Unverified
8RoBERTaSmoothed BLEU-45.72Unverified
#ModelMetricClaimedVerifiedStatus
1CodeTrans-MT-BaseSmoothed BLEU-426.23Unverified
2CodeBERT (MLM+RTD)Smoothed BLEU-421.32Unverified
3CodeBERT (MLM)Smoothed BLEU-421Unverified
4pre-train w/ code onlySmoothed BLEU-420.71Unverified
5CodeBERT (RTD)Smoothed BLEU-420.25Unverified
6RoBERTaSmoothed BLEU-419.9Unverified
7seq2seqSmoothed BLEU-418.4Unverified
8TransformerSmoothed BLEU-418.25Unverified
#ModelMetricClaimedVerifiedStatus
1CodeBERT (MLM+RTD)Smoothed BLEU-415.99Unverified
2CodeBERT (MLM)Smoothed BLEU-415.55Unverified
3pre-train w/ code onlySmoothed BLEU-415.15Unverified
4CodeBERT (RTD)Smoothed BLEU-415.03Unverified
5RoBERTaSmoothed BLEU-414.52Unverified
6TransformerSmoothed BLEU-414.31Unverified
7seq2seqSmoothed BLEU-413.36Unverified
#ModelMetricClaimedVerifiedStatus
1CodeBERT (MLM)Smoothed BLEU-426.79Unverified
2CodeBERT (MLM+RTD)Smoothed BLEU-426.66Unverified
3pre-train w/ code onlySmoothed BLEU-426.39Unverified
4RoBERTaSmoothed BLEU-426.09Unverified
5CodeBERT (RTD)Smoothed BLEU-426.02Unverified
6seq2seqSmoothed BLEU-423.48Unverified
7CodeTrans-TF-LargeSmoothed BLEU-419.54Unverified
#ModelMetricClaimedVerifiedStatus
1CodeTrans-MT-BaseSmoothed BLEU-420.39Unverified
2CodeBERT (MLM)Smoothed BLEU-415.48Unverified
3CodeBERT (MLM+RTD)Smoothed BLEU-415.41Unverified
4pre-train w/ code onlySmoothed BLEU-415.12Unverified
5RoBERTaSmoothed BLEU-414.92Unverified
6TransformerSmoothed BLEU-413.44Unverified
7seq2seqSmoothed BLEU-413.04Unverified
#ModelMetricClaimedVerifiedStatus
1CodeTrans-MT-BaseSmoothed BLEU-415.26Unverified
2CodeBERT (MLM+RTD)Smoothed BLEU-48.46Unverified
3CodeBERT (MLM)Smoothed BLEU-47.95Unverified
4TransformerSmoothed BLEU-47.87Unverified
5pre-train w/ code onlySmoothed BLEU-47.36Unverified
6RoBERTaSmoothed BLEU-47.26Unverified
7seq2seqSmoothed BLEU-46.96Unverified